Recent inspections
Health surveyMay 2026 · CMS1 deficiencies
- F-812SS E — Procure food from sources approved or considered satisfactory and store, prepare, distribute and serve food in accordance with professional standards.
Health surveyMar 2025 · CMS10 deficiencies
- F-641SS D — Ensure each resident receives an accurate assessment.
- F-656SS D — Develop and implement a complete care plan that meets all the resident's needs, with timetables and actions that can be measured.
- F-657SS E — Develop the complete care plan within 7 days of the comprehensive assessment; and prepared, reviewed, and revised by a team of health professionals.
- F-658SS F — Ensure services provided by the nursing facility meet professional standards of quality.
- F-727SS F — Have a registered nurse on duty 8 hours a day; and select a registered nurse to be the director of nurses on a full time basis.
- F-761SS F — Ensure drugs and biologicals used in the facility are labeled in accordance with currently accepted professional principles; and all drugs and biologicals must be stored in locked compartments, separately locked, compartments for controlled drugs.
- F-803SS E — Ensure menus must meet the nutritional needs of residents, be prepared in advance, be followed, be updated, be reviewed by dietician, and meet the needs of the resident.
- F-812SS F — Procure food from sources approved or considered satisfactory and store, prepare, distribute and serve food in accordance with professional standards.
- F-880SS E — Provide and implement an infection prevention and control program.
- F-912SS E — Provide rooms that are at least 80 square feet per resident in multiple rooms and 100 square feet for single resident rooms.
